A majority of mechanics finish up with a high-school diploma and then join an automotive training program that lasts from 6 months to 2 years in Philadelphia. The Philadelphia Technician Training Institute (PTTI) offers students the practical learning experience in auto repair skills such as diagnostics, brake systems, engines, electrical work, and high-tech automotive systems. The program which is focused on the automotive industry prepares you for ASE certification, real-world shop environments, and entry-level auto mechanic jobs in Philadelphia. Certified auto technicians are highly sought-after, hence, there are ample opportunities available in dealerships, auto shops, and fleet maintenance companies.
